Towards hardware acceleration for parton densities estimation
Stefano Carrazza🇮🇹 · Juan Cruz-Martinez🇮🇹 · Jesús Urtasun-Elizari🇮🇹 · Emilio Villa🇮🇹
Abstract
In this proceedings we describe the computational challenges associated to the determination of parton distribution functions (PDFs). We compare the performance of the convolution of the parton distributions with matrix elements using different hardware instructions. We quantify and identify the most promising data-model configurations to increase PDF fitting performance in adapting the current code frameworks to hardware accelerators such as graphics processing units.
